The first one is a fun masculine card, that I created with the Hanging with My Gnomies stamp set. I stamped two of the gnomes on some Copic Friendly paper and went to work…

List of Copic markers used for two different cards

  • Skin color: E11, E21, E000, E04, E20
  • Left gnome: E59, E37, E35, E31, G07, G05, G03+black Prismacolor pencil
  • Right gnome: W7, W5, W3, W00, B06, B04, B02
  • Background: BG01, BG00, G46, G43

Next, I framed the little scene with a couple of stacked Polaroid frames, die cut with the Polaroid Shaker Frame Die-namics. It was the perfect spot to partially stamp the sentiment, also from the Hanging with My Gnomies stamp set. I then heat embossed the rest of the sentiment in white, on a small Licorice Black stitched circle.

I cut an A2 top fold cardbase in Cement Gray Prestige Card Stock and adhered  a piece of stamped paper from the Woodgrain Whimsy Paper Pack to the front. It’s so different and fun!

Finally, when assembling all of the elements, I decided to add a pop of green with some leaves. I diecut them out of Jellybean Green and Gumdrop Green card stock using the Grande Greenery Solid Die-namics.

I also wanted to use the cute Rainbow Whimsy Die-namics, which is our “Free with $60” product, to create a CAS second card. I diecut the rainbow out of my favorite rainbow combo of card stock; Red Hot, Orange Zest, Pineapple Prestige, Sour Apple and Blu Raspberry

…and inlaid the strips in an A2 panel, diecut with the largest die from the A2 Stitched Rectangle STAX Set 1 Die-namics.

For the sentiment, i die cut the Good Luck Greeting Die-namics out of Licorice Black Card Stock backed with Stick-It adhesive and covered it with a layer of Glossy Accents. Once it was dry, I adhered it to my panel. As a final touch, I added some crystal drops.
